Symptoms

Inattention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ity are all symptoms of ADHD. In order for someone to be classified as having the disorder the symptoms must be significantly more than what is typical for their age and developmental level. They should also be experiencing significant issues at school, work, home and in their relationships. These symptoms must have been present for at minimum a year. Diagnosis

If you or your child believes they might have ADHD A diagnosis can help you to gain control over the symptoms that impact your personal and work life. Many people suffering from ADHD say that their lives have improved once they why get diagnosed with adhd a diagnosis. They may also be able to get accommodations at work or school.

A licensed health professional should make the diagnosis. The test can be performed by a mental health professional such as a psychologist or psychiatrist, or by primary care providers like the family physician or pediatrician. Often the person will ask their physician to refer them to a specialist with expertise in diagnosing ADHD.

The person who evaluates the patient will review their medical, psychiatric and family history since childhood. The examiner will also talk to family members, teachers and close friends to determine the diagnosis. It is important that you be truthful with the professional so that they can get accurate information.

To be able to be diagnosed with ADHD, the symptoms must be affecting the ability of the person to perform at home and at school. In addition the evaluator can exclude other conditions that can have similar symptoms to ADHD like sleep disorders or certain kinds of learning disabilities.

Psychiatrylogo-IamPsychiatry.pngChildren are more likely to be diagnosed with ADHD, especially the combined type of the disorder more than adults. A doctor will assess the child's ADHD by talking to the teen and his or her parents and asking the teenager to complete the scale of rating specially designed for this type of condition. He or she will also observe the teen's behavior. In addition, the doctor will discuss any disciplinary action taken against the teen by school officials.

An adult who wishes to be diagnosed with ADHD will typically be asked to complete a rating scale that includes questions about inattentiveness, hyperactivity and the tendency to be impulsive. The evaluator may also examine the history of the patient to determine how their symptoms have changed over time. To be diagnosed with ADHD an adult or adolescent has to show five or more symptoms as described in the DSM-5, a psychiatric guide.

Treatments

A licensed health specialist can help determine if someone has ADHD. A thorough evaluation typically includes interviews with the person and their family members, teachers and employer, a complete medical and family history as well as psychiatric and diagnostic tests and behavioral assessments. A trained practitioner can identify the person based on their behavior over time and how that interferes with their daily activities.

People suffering from ADHD can select from a range of treatment options. Most people with ADHD are treated with a combination of therapy for behavioral disorders and medication. The most effective treatment for children in school is stimulant medicine, often with counseling and educational accommodations.

Many adults with ADHD can benefit from cognitive behavioral therapy, which can help people develop new skills to manage symptoms and improve their psychological well-being. Support

People with ADHD often feel isolated due to the many problems they face in their lives. Support groups are ideal for talking about your issues and seek assistance from other people with similar issues. Yoga and meditation can assist those suffering from the disorder to relax and lessen stress. These techniques can help increase focus and attention, and decrease impulsivity.

The signs of ADHD can occur at any age, but to be recognized, they must have been present from childhood and cause problems in more than one area of your life, including home, school or work. These symptoms must also be persistent and last for adhd diagnosis london longer than normal lengths of time, and not just in times of stress or fatigue.

The evaluator will ask about the person's symptoms and how they impact their daily life. They can use questionnaires or ask family and friends about their symptoms and perform a physical examination. They might also have to ensure that the person does not have an illness that could cause similar symptoms, like anxiety or depression.
